Background notes

Archive material and source history

Fiji Blue formed in Australia in 1994, with Mark Holden, Dale Ryder, and John Watson as its core members. They released their self-titled debut album that same year, followed by a series of records like "2" in 1995 and "Bless This Mess" in 1997. Their song "It Takes Two" sparked some debate, with the band defending it as a message of inclusivity.

Holden handled lead vocals and songwriting, while Ryder contributed guitar work. Their music includes tracks such as "Waves" and "Affection," which fit into their broader catalog without dramatic claims about chart success or global impact. The band kept a steady lineup through the late '90s, avoiding the typical breakup-and-reunion cycles of many groups from that era.

They put out "The Fifth Element" in 1998, rounding out a period of consistent output. Details beyond this are sparse, so it's best to leave their story there rather than speculate on later years or legacy.
